Exploring the Uber Landscape: Driver Experiences and Challenges
Driving for Uber can be a flexible way to earn income, but it's not without its challenges. Drivers often face volatile demand, leading to periods of scarcity work. Crowding among drivers can also impact earnings, particularly in busy areas.
Fuel costs and vehicle maintenance are ongoing expenses that drivers must manage. Additionally, navigating traffic and locating parking spots can be time-consuming and annoying. Despite these hurdles, many Uber drivers find the job satisfying due to its freedom and the ability to set their own hours.
- Several drivers also appreciate the opportunity to interact with diverse passengers.
- However, concerns over security, both for drivers and passengers, remain a significant issue in the industry.
It's essential for Uber to continue working on resolving these challenges to ensure a positive experience for both drivers and riders.
Regulation vs. Innovation: Uber's Ongoing Battles with Governments
Uber, the ride-hailing leader, has become a symbol of the modern battle between oversight and disruption. Since its debut in 2009, Uber has faced intense opposition from traditional taxi companies and government regulators worldwide. Critics argue that Uber's approach threatens public safety and takes advantage of drivers, while supporters maintain that it provides a affordable alternative to existing transportation. This ongoing conflict has led to a complex check here landscape of restrictions that persist to shape the future of ride-hailing and travel.
